| Aspect | Conference Service Coordinator | Event Coordinator |
|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ires hospitality, hospitality management, or related certifications | Often requires event planning, hospitality, or related certifications |
| Work Environment | Hotels, conference centers, convention venues | Various settings including corporate, social, and nonprofit events |
| Employer & Industry | Hotels, conference centers, event venues | Event planning companies, corporations, nonprofits |
| Primary Focus | Managing conference logistics, room arrangements, and client needs | Planning and executing diverse events, including weddings, corporate events, and social gatherings |
The main difference is that Conference Service Coordinators focus specifically on managing conference logistics within hospitality venues, while Event Coordinators handle a broader range of events across various industries. Both roles require strong organizational skills and customer service, but their scope and typical settings differ.
